We all like to be successful but sometimes we drift along without knowing what that might be, how to start that journey and what milestones you can go through on route.

Here is how to get started

Find a place you feel comfortable.

Follow these coaching questions

Reflect and or answer

Discuss with a friend and or trusted colleague

Identify consciously what might be stopping you

List the resources in time, people, physical resource, investment what you need

Place a time in the diary when you will start and when you will update your progress and reassess the best way to get there (repeat regularly)

Answer these questions

  1. What is your picture of success?
  2. What do you see, hear and feel when you have success?
  3. What steps have you used in the past to achieve success?
  4. Which of your strengths will support meeting your success?
  5. How will you identify areas of your system to develop?
  6. Which of your team, individual and or organisation strengths can you utilise to maximise the impact and success?
  7. What will you do to get started?
  8. When will you start?
